Conversion formula
The conversion factor from deciliters to tablespoons is 6.762804511761, which means that 1 deciliter is equal to 6.762804511761 tablespoons:
1 dL = 6.762804511761 tbsp
To convert 637 deciliters into tablespoons we have to multiply 637 by the conversion factor in order to get the volume amount from deciliters to tablespoons. We can also form a simple proportion to calculate the result:
1 dL → 6.762804511761 tbsp
637 dL → V(tbsp)
Solve the above proportion to obtain the volume V in tablespoons:
V(tbsp) = 637 dL × 6.762804511761 tbsp
V(tbsp) = 4307.9064739918 tbsp
The final result is:
637 dL → 4307.9064739918 tbsp
We conclude that 637 deciliters is equivalent to 4307.9064739918 tablespoons:
637 deciliters = 4307.9064739918 tablespoons
